Fletcher-Smith Joins Bell Tower Shops
Amy Fletcher-Smith has joined the staff of Bell Tower Shops as director of marketing. She is responsible for advertising, community and media relations, event coordination and related activities for the landmark shopping, dining and entertainment destination.
Before joining Bell Tower Shops, Fletcher-Smith served as director of marketing and advertising for Bonita Springs-based Bonita Bay Group. She has more than a decade of marketing experience, including four years as director of public relations for Paradigm/Lord & Lasker in Tampa. Her work has been recognized with awards from the Lee Building Industry Association and National Association of Homebuilders. She has served on the board of directors of the Gulf Coast Humane Society, on allocation teams for United Way of Lee County. Fletcher-Smith is a graduate of Florida State University with a bachelor’s degree in communications and English/creative writing.
Bell Tower Shops is an open-air lifestyle center, located at U.S. 41 and Daniels Parkway, with 40 retailers, including Saks Fifth Avenue and The Fresh Market, nine restaurants and Bell Tower 20 Regal Cinemas. The center’s sidewalk garden setting of lush landscaping, splashing fountains and covered walkways makes it a popular gathering place. Survey Café Celebrates Grand Opening
The Survey Café is celebrated their grand opening on March 28. Located in a historic home turned Café where local art and antique tools adorn the walls, the Café offers a nostalgic Florida experience. The Survey Café is across from Riverside Park in Downtown Bonita Springs at 10530 Wilson Street, just south of the Imperial River.
The grand opening featured samples, door prizes, and the opportunity to meet and chat with Chef Sandy and owners, Ben and Lori Nelson. The Café features Grounds for Change Organic Fair-Trade Coffee and uses Eco-Products. There are many organic and natural items on the menu, including Not Just Breakfast Bars, made fresh daily.

Bonita Bay Group communities contributed to United Way Campaign
Residents of five Bonita Bay Group communities, the Bonita Springs-based developer and its employees contributed more than $1.3 million to the recently completed United Way of Lee, Hendry and Glades campaign. Their combined contribution represented more than a fifth of the $8,019,741 campaign total.
Bonita Bay residents, who first began raising money for United Way in 1998, made the second largest contribution to this year’s campaign — $866,000 — second only to Publix Super Markets for the ninth consecutive year. Bonita Bay Group employee pledges were matched dollar for dollar by Chairman David Lucas, generating $446,000 and a third-place ranking on the list of the top United Way contributors.
When Bonita Bay residents ran the region’s first community campaign, they not only raised $64,000 but also created a model for United Way giving in master-planned communities. This year, 14 Lee County communities ran United Way campaigns, including The Brooks in Bonita Springs, which ranked seventh with $198,000, and Mediterra in North Naples, which was ninth at $180,000. Verandah residents in Fort Myers organized their third United Way campaign and raised $61,000, and the inaugural campaign at Sandoval in Cape Coral raised $2,300.
